Gabe will receive support for the adoption and implementation of the updated Creighton Competency Evaluation Instrument (CCEI) 2.0 within the nursing program. This project involves replacing the current CCEI instrument with the validated CCEI 2.0 version, configuring it within SimCapture for use across clinical and simulation courses, and aligning the new assessment workflows with the expanding clinical simulation operations in the Simulation Center.
